Proview reportedly willing to talk in iPad trademark dispute
Proview Technology, the Chinese company suing Apple over its iPad trademark in China says it's open to talks, according to the "Associated Press" (http://macte.ch/hJ56T). However, Apple has shown no interest in such a settlement , the video report adds. Apple has threatened to take legal action against the Chinese tech firm for inflaming an ongoing dispute over the iPad trademark. Apple says that the company's founder and its lawyers have made misleading statements that could damage the U.S. tech giant's business in China, reports "PCWorld" (http://macte.ch/1CkXM). read more...
